Garden Wall Lights

First impressions are lasting impressions. When people visit your home for the first time, especially in the evening hours, their first impression is not going to be the pristine foyer with mahogany floors; it is going to be your lawn and outdoor area of your home. Garden wall lights add ambience and show that as much thought went into planning your outdoor area as did planning your interior design.

Outdoor wall light on your porch walls accompanied by post lighting for your drive creates a welcoming entrance to lead your guests from the street to your front door. Using timers, photocells, or traditional switches you can have your pathways lit up at dusk.

Adding garden wall lights is a study in both form and function. At the same time you are designing and planning your artistic masterpiece for your lawn you are also adding a security feature to your home. Burglars tend to shy away from lit up yards.

night-houseGarden wall lights come in a wide range of styles and materials. You can choose from the very plain to the most intricate of designs. Materials range from the tried and true bronze to cast iron and pretty much any other material that can withstand the weather and heat from the bulbs.

Lighting types vary from wall sconces, post lighting, and lately even chandeliers. Wall sconces are most often found on porch walls, garage walls, or gazebos. One popular trend in wall sconces are natural gas powered sconces whose light comes from flame, reminiscent of the days of old. These are often designed in the style of old hanging lanterns.

Chandeliers are becoming popular choices for gazebos and patios. Chandeliers that are designed for outdoor use occasionally come with ceiling fans mounted to add a breeze to the porch.

Fixture designs can be found in styles from ultra modern and art deco to old world traditional and gothic style. Using the style and theme of your garden and home your garden wall lights will become a part of your overall house design.

Garden wall lights can be equipped with several user options such as dimmers, motion detectors or photocells. Photocells are particularly popular due to eliminating the need for turning the lights on and off. The lights come on at dark and turn themselves off during the daylight.

Homeowners can add spice and variety to their garden wall lights with their choice of bulbs. There are energy efficient bulbs, fluorescent bulbs and colored bulbs. Using LED lights that are available in a variety of colors homeowners can complement the garden area, pool area or more with the garden wall lights.

Lawns that require retaining walls have a unique opportunity to use garden wall lights to add focus to the area or bring an air of mystic to the garden. Recessed lighting built into the retaining well is a particularly pleasant lighting arrangement.

Planning your lighting design is a creative process that has many possibilities. Garden wall lights are not just for porches. They can be used for porch walls, garage walls, retaining walls, gazebos and more. From sconces to chandeliers the choices are vast.
